How much does it cost to rent an apartment in High Springs?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
High Springs Studio Apartments | $1,061 | $940 | $1,235 |
High Springs 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,603 | $900 | $2,612 |
High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,836 | $1,100 | $3,560 |
High Springs 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,873 | $579 | $2,869 |
High Springs 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,100 | $474 | $2,657 |

Frequently Asked Questions about High Springs
What is the current price range for One Bedroom High Springs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in High Springs ranges from $900 to $2,612 with an average monthly rent of $1,603.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in High Springs c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in High Springs range from $1,100 to $3,560.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,836.
How expensive are High Springs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in High Springs on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$579 to $2,869 - averaging $1,873 for the location.
